EMSL Arrows is a revolutionary approach to materials and chemical simulations that uses NWChem and chemical computational databases to make materials and chemical modeling accessible via a broad spectrum of digital communications including posts to web APIs, social networks, and traditional email. |
Molecular modeling software has previously been extremely complex, making it prohibative to all but experts in the field, yet even experts can struggle to perform calculations. This service is designed to be used by experts and non-experts alike. Experts can carry out and keep track of large numbers of complex calculations with diverse levels of theories present in their workflows. Additionally, due to a streamlined and easy-to-use input, non-experts can carry out a wide variety of molecular modeling calculations previously not accessible to them.
